禅道项目管理软件攻略:从入门到精通的全流程实战指南
在当今快速变化的商业环境中,高效、透明的项目管理已成为企业竞争力的核心要素。禅道(ZenTao)作为一款国产开源的项目管理工具,凭借其强大的功能整合能力、灵活的定制化选项以及对敏捷开发模式的深度支持,正被越来越多的企业和团队采纳。然而,许多用户在初次接触禅道时,往往面临配置复杂、流程不清晰、团队协作效率低等问题。本文将为你系统梳理禅道项目管理软件的完整攻略,涵盖从安装部署、基础设置、核心功能使用,到高级技巧与最佳实践,帮助你从零开始掌握禅道,实现项目管理的精细化与智能化。
一、禅道是什么?为什么选择它?
禅道是一款集需求管理、任务分配、缺陷跟踪、测试用例管理、文档管理及报表统计于一体的项目管理平台。它不仅适用于软件研发团队,也广泛应用于产品、设计、运营等多部门协同的项目场景。相比国外同类工具如Jira或Redmine,禅道的优势在于:
- 本地化适配强:界面友好、中文支持完善,符合国内用户的操作习惯。
- 成本低:开源免费版本功能强大,企业版则提供更完善的售后和技术支持。
- 敏捷开发友好:内置Scrum和Kanban看板,支持冲刺计划、燃尽图等功能,贴合敏捷团队工作流。
- 数据安全可控:可部署于内网服务器,适合对数据隐私要求高的企业。
二、如何正确安装与初始化禅道?
第一步是环境准备:推荐使用Linux服务器(如CentOS)+ Apache/Nginx + MySQL + PHP组合,确保PHP版本不低于7.2且开启相关扩展(如PDO、GD、cURL等)。下载最新稳定版禅道后,通过命令行或图形化界面完成安装向导,填写数据库信息、管理员账号密码即可完成初始化。
关键提醒:
- 首次登录后立即修改默认管理员密码,避免安全隐患。
- 根据组织架构创建部门与角色,明确权限边界(如项目经理、开发人员、测试人员等)。
- 启用“项目生命周期”模块,为每个项目设定状态(立项、开发中、测试中、上线、归档),便于流程管控。
三、核心功能详解:需求、任务、缺陷闭环管理
禅道最核心的价值体现在其“需求-任务-缺陷”的全链路追踪体系:
1. 需求管理(Product Backlog)
所有项目起点都是需求。建议采用“用户故事”形式记录需求内容,包含优先级、预计工时、验收标准等字段。可通过甘特图视图查看各需求的排期情况,并将其拆分为多个迭代版本(Sprint)。
2. 任务分配(Task Assignment)
需求落地为具体任务后,需指派给责任人并设定截止日期。禅道支持按角色、技能标签自动推荐负责人,减少沟通成本。每日站会时,团队成员可在任务卡片上更新进度,形成可视化的工作推进轨迹。
3. 缺陷跟踪(Bug Management)
缺陷管理是质量保障的关键环节。当测试发现Bug时,应立即录入禅道,标注严重程度、复现步骤、所属模块等信息。开发人员认领后进入修复流程,修复完成后由测试人员验证关闭。整个过程留痕清晰,责任分明。
四、进阶技巧:利用禅道提升团队效率
仅仅使用基础功能还远远不够,要想真正发挥禅道的价值,需要掌握以下高级玩法:
1. 自定义字段与流程审批
针对特定行业或项目类型(如医疗、金融),可添加自定义字段(如合规编号、客户名称),并通过“流程审批”机制实现多级审核,比如代码提交前必须经过技术主管审批。
2. 数据报表与绩效分析
禅道内置丰富的报表模板,包括任务完成率、缺陷分布热力图、燃尽图、个人产出统计等。定期生成周报/月报,有助于管理层洞察团队健康度,并用于绩效考核。
3. API集成与自动化脚本
对于已有CI/CD流水线的团队,可通过禅道提供的RESTful API接口,将Git提交、构建结果、测试报告等自动同步至禅道,实现从开发到交付的无缝衔接。
4. 多项目并行管理
若企业同时开展多个项目,建议建立“项目空间”概念,每个项目独立配置权限、模板和里程碑。借助“跨项目搜索”功能,方便管理者全局把控资源利用率。
五、常见问题与解决方案
新手常遇到的问题包括:
- 权限混乱导致误操作:解决办法是在“权限模型”中细化到具体模块的操作权限(如只读、编辑、删除),避免非授权人员随意更改数据。
- 任务卡住无人认领:可通过“任务提醒”插件定时发送邮件通知责任人,或设置超时自动转交机制。
- 报表数据不准:检查是否统一了时间标准(如UTC+8)、是否按时更新状态(如未完成的任务不能标记为“已完成”)。
六、总结:让禅道成为你的项目管理利器
禅道项目管理软件并非只是一个工具,而是一种思维方式的转变——从经验驱动走向数据驱动。只要掌握了正确的使用方法,就能显著提升团队协作效率、降低沟通成本、增强项目透明度。无论你是初学者还是资深项目经理,都应该将禅道纳入日常工作中,持续优化流程,打造高效能团队。